Formerly Prince Borommaracha, Borommaracha III was the son of Trailokanat.
Prince Borommaracha served as Trailokanat’s regent in Ayutthaya during his father’s campaigns against Lanna in the north. Trailokanat died in 1488 and Prince Borommaracha succeeded his father. Upon ascension, he moved the capital back to Ayutthaya.
His reign, however, was short.
He sent Siamese armies to capture the Mon city of Tavoy in 1491 and died the same year.
